Yes: Yes, 20 is a good age for teeth bleaching. Normally younger patients tend to have more of a problem with sensitivity. This is due to the nerves of the teeth being closer to the surface in younger patients. There are ways of reducing the sensitivity. Talk to your dentist to get their advise.
